Technical field
The utility model belongs to wood processing technique field, particularly relates to a kind of timber machining high-precision wrapping machine.
Background technology
Lagging Technical comparing domestic at present falls behind, the main dependence on import of high accuracy wrapping machine, but the wrapping machine complicated operation of import, cost is higher, such as Chinese patent 201420195698.2 discloses a kind of batten wrapping machine, the utility model belongs to wood processing equipment technical field, relates to a kind of batten wrapping machine.Solve prior art complex structure, processing cost high-technology problem.It comprises support and is located at the drive motors on support, hydraulic cavities is provided with in described support, support top and be symmetrically arranged with two along support center line and connect the hydraulic mechanism of drive motors, described hydraulic mechanism comprises the hydraulic cylinder connecting drive motors, hydraulic cylinder output is fixedly connected with depression bar, described depression bar extends in hydraulic cavities, the briquetting of the affixed strip in depression bar top, be positioned at below depression bar and be also provided with stock mould in hydraulic cavities, described stock mould comprises the die ontology with die cavity, has space between die ontology both sides and hydraulic cavities inwall.This common wrapping machine roll shaft consumption is comparatively large, needs artificial roll shaft to adjust after using a period of time, and dismounting roll shaft is very inconvenient.
Summary of the invention
The utility model provides and a kind of timber machining high-precision wrapping machine, to solve the problem of the dismounting roll shaft inconvenience proposed in above-mentioned background technology.
The technical problem that the utility model solves realizes by the following technical solutions: the utility model provides and a kind of timber machining high-precision wrapping machine, it is characterized in that: comprise cabinet, cavity is provided with in described cabinet, the first support column is provided with in described cavity, second support column, described first support column, mandrel is provided with between second support column, the outer surface cover of described mandrel has roll shaft, the outer surface cover of described roll shaft has conveyer belt, the first bracing frame is provided with above described cabinet, second bracing frame, described first bracing frame is provided with the first circular hole, described second bracing frame is provided with the second circular hole, described first circular hole, driven shaft is provided with in second circular hole, the first anti-skid sleeve is provided with in described first circular hole, the second anti-skid sleeve is provided with in described second circular hole, described first anti-skid sleeve, second anti-skid sleeve is all enclosed within the outside of driven shaft, described driven shaft is provided with roll shaft, described roll shaft is positioned at the first bracing frame, between second bracing frame, described first bracing frame, crossbeam is provided with above second bracing frame, the first motor is provided with above described crossbeam, second motor, described first motor is connected with the first driving shaft, described first driving shaft and the outer surface cover of driven shaft have the first Timing Belt, described second motor is connected with the second driving shaft, described second driving shaft and the outer surface cover of driven shaft have the second Timing Belt, the first limited post is provided with between described first bracing frame and cabinet, the second limited post is provided with between described second bracing frame and cabinet, the outer surface cover of described first limited post has the first limit spring, the outer surface cover of described second limited post has the second limit spring.
Described roll shaft equidistant arrangement.
Described first support column, the second support column are symmetrical arranged.
The beneficial effects of the utility model are:
The technical program by arranging limited post and limit spring between bracing frame and cabinet, can by adjusting limit spring thus the angle of adjustment roll shaft, handled easily, bracing frame and crossbeam are set above cabinet, two motors are placed on crossbeam, the floor space of equipment can be saved, driven shaft is through bracing frame, make structure more firm, be provided with cavity in casing, the fragment after cutting can drop down onto in cavity, avoids contaminated environment, anti-skid sleeve can be avoided skidding between driven shaft and bracing frame, ensures the normal work of equipment.
